New Poll: Georgia Senator by Research 2000 on 2008-11-25

Summary: D: 46%, R: 52%, U: 2%

R2K has another poll out today that has it at 52-46. They say that Martin leads among early voters 56% to 44%.


How much was Martin leading by in the early voting for the Nov. 4th election?


56% to 39% to 5%. However, black turnout was 35% of early voting then. Now it's only 23%.
